Eighteen Good Gym runners braved the rain and the dark, and the hills of Healey , to help Healey Green Veg clear a derelict garden so that it can be brought bag in to use. Gareth from Regather joined us with a selection of tools and we set about digging, hacking, pulling and barrowing: there was just one instruction - 'I want to see bare earth!' So we dug and we hacked and we pulled and we barrowed and the rain fell and some people got so into the task they had to be persuaded to stop. Then time for a group photo and it was all down hill back to the Showroom to celebrate Stephen and Kim's birthday with cake.

Heeley Green Veg
Helping to develop a community vegetable growing space

Hello, our names are Fran, Katy and Simon and we live on Alexandra Road and Derby Street. It makes us sad that the old garden at the top of Alexandra Road/ bottom of Denmark Road is an absolute mess. We have spoken with the council and they have given us provisional permission to get together and turn it into a community vegetable growing space! The three of us have already started working on the garden but we would love to meet others who would like to help. There are jobs for everyone to be involved with, from digging over the soil to chatting and sharing gardening knowledge. Our aim is to reduce social isolation, foster community ties and promote friendship. We will be heading along and helping the project get off the ground/into the ground.
